ROME CLAIMS SUCCESS.
GREEK AND AFRICAN FRONTS. (Reed. 10 a.m.) - LONDON - , Dec. 25. A Rome communique states: "Our artillery on the Cyrenaica frontier battered enemy armoured units. We successfully bombed mechanised forces. Our fighters shot down two Hurricanes. One of our planes did not return. "We repulsed several attacks on the Greek frontier and captured some prisoners, machine-guns and rifles. We repulsed an enemy detachment on the Sudanese frontier."
